Not sure about ethanol, but we used to run our methanol bikes a lot richer,
like 5x the volume of fuel compared to petrol.  Engines ran cooler and made
more power.

Ethanol should have more available carbons for oxygen than methanol but not
as many as regular petrol, so I would think that you could experiment with
going slightly richer.  I would also think that the oxygen sensor in the
exhaust should pick up excess O2 and cause the mixture to richer
automatically.

So, all you should notice with an efi bike is slightly (maybe 5% ?) heavier
fuel consumption.  I wonder if this happens in practice.
